With the 2023 Daytona 500 approaching, NASCAR will begin its preseason with the 2023 Busch Light Clash at the Coliseum. A quarter mile track was built into the Los Angeles Memorial Coliseum known to have hosted several Olympic Games and Super Bowls as well as the 1959 World Series. Kyle Busch won pole at last year’s Clash at the Coliseum and led 65 laps of the 150-lap feature, but Joey Logano edged him out at the finish. Logano is an 8-1 co-favourite in the latest 2023 Clash at the Coliseum odds. Kyle Larson, Chase Elliott and Kyle Busch have won the last three NASCAR titles and they are also 8-1 on the NASCAR odds board while Christopher Bell is 10-1. The green flag is expected to drop at 8:00 p.m. ET in the 23-car, 150-lap main race.
